
James Nesbitt
James Nesbitt is a prominent Northern Irish actor known for his versatile performances in film and television. He gained widespread recognition for his role in the BBC drama 'The Missing', where he portrayed a father searching for his missing son, showcasing his ability to deliver emotionally powerful performances.
